What You’ll Need

Gather these ingredients to create your sliders:

For the Sliders

  • 1 pound ground beef
  • 1 tablespoon Worcestershire sauce
  • Salt and pepper to taste

For the Cheese

  • 1 cup shredded cheese (cheddar or American)

For the Buns

  • 1 package slider buns

For Serving

  • Pickles (optional)
  • Ketchup (optional)
  • Mustard (optional)

Use your favorite cheese for a unique twist.

Substitutions & Swaps

  • Ground turkey can replace ground beef.
  • Any cheese variety works well.
  • Whole wheat buns are a healthier option.
  • Skip the Worcestershire for a simple flavor.

How to Make It

Prepare these sliders in just a few easy steps.

Preheat

Preheat the oven to 350°F (175°C).

Mix

In a bowl, mix ground beef, Worcestershire sauce, salt, and pepper.

Cheeseburger Sliders

Form

Form the mixture into small patties that fit the slider buns.

Cook

Cook the patties on a grill or stovetop until fully cooked, about 3-4 minutes per side.

Assemble

Place the patties on the slider buns and top with shredded cheese.

Bake

Put the sliders on a baking sheet and bake in the oven for 5-7 minutes until the cheese is melted.

Serve

Serve with pickles, ketchup, and mustard if desired.

Tips for Best Results

  • Ensure patties are evenly shaped for consistent cooking.
  • Use fresh slider buns for the best texture.
  • Don’t skip baking; it ensures melty, delicious cheese.
  • Customize your sliders with toppings of your choice.
